NEW YORK, NY - Rosewood Realty Group announced the $133 million sale of two large multifamily properties totaling 814 units in Atlanta as the company’s National Investment Sales Division spreads to another state beyond New York City. Rosewood Realty’s Jonathan Brody and Elliot Haft successfully facilitated the sale of a substantial multifamily portfolio in Atlanta, Georgia. Both Brody and Haft represented the buyer Venterra Realty, a Toronto based Real Estate Company. “We have been working with Venterra for quite some time in multiple states and happy to get a deal done with them in Atlanta.” said Brody who was appointed in January by Rosewood’s Founder & CEO Aaron Jungreis to lead the company’s new National Investment Sales division to focus on off-market multifamily transactions nationally. ....
Rosewood Realty Group National Investment Sales Division has closed on the $133 million acquisition of a multifamily portfolio in Atlanta, GA, on behalf of Canadian real estate company, Venterra Realty. The acquisition included 309 units at The Whitney at Sandy Springs and 505-units at The Harrison, both located in the Sandy Spring submarket of Atlanta. Rosewood’s Jonathan Brody and Elliot Haft represented Venterra Realty. CBRE represented the seller, Covenant Capital Group.
